SURFACE TRANSPORTATION BOARD TO HOLD PUBLIC HEARING ON CASE INVOLVING COAL DUST ISSUE [WEBSITE REMINDER]


The Surface Transportation Board will hold a public hearing on Thursday, July 29 on a case that centers on whether a railroad may deny service to coal shippers who do not follow the railroad's rules on coal dust dispersal.


The case, Arkansas Electric Cooperative Corporation—Petition for Declaratory Order, Docket No. FD 35305, raises the issues of whether BNSF Railway Co. may establish rules regarding coal dust dispersion from coal trains operating over its lines and if it can refuse to provide rail service to shippers who do not comply with its rules. The Board will decide if this constitutes an unreasonable practice and whether the provision would violate BNSF's common carrier obligation.


The hearing is scheduled for 9:30 a.m. at STB Headquarters, 395 E Street SW, Washington, D.C. The hearing will be open to the public, but only parties of record in the case will be permitted to speak. Parties wishing to participate must file a notice of intent no later than June 18.


A video broadcast of the hearing will be available through the Board's website at www.stb.dot.gov.
